
The Nintendo DS’s charge port looks a lot like a mini USB plug. In fact, it really is, just modified a bit. One enterprising hacker, tired of plugging his DS into the wall, no doubt, decided he’d make his DS USB-compatible. And although it seems to have been a relatively straightforward operation, I question the practicality of it when there are USB charge cables for the DS for $4.
The instructions are here, but he’s careful to warn readers that this is really more of an experiment than something that everyone should be doing. Still, it’d be one less cable to carry around with you.
